Set in a working-class neighborhood in Stockholm, the story revolves around a young man named Bengt who falls into deep, private turmoil with the unexpected death of his mother. As he struggles to cope with her loss, his despair slowly transforms to rage when he discovers his father had a mistress. But as Bengt swears revenge on behalf of his mothers memory, he also finds himself drawn into a fevered and conflicted relationship with this womana turn that causes him to question his previous faith in morality, virtue, and fidelity.
